In this episode of the CAFE Insider podcast, "Scandal Survey: Donald, Brett, Andy, Felicity," co-hosts Preet Bharara and Anne Milgram discuss:
-- The reporting about a potential indictment of former Deputy FBI Director Andrew McCabe
-- Concerns raised by spending at President Trump’s hotels
-- Actress Felicity Huffman’s 14-day jail sentence for her role in the college admissions scandal
-- A New York Times article about sexual harassment allegations made against Justice Brett Kavanaugh from his time as a Yale undergraduate student
